#225 - Stock Market History Is Repeating Itself

  • Summary

  • Better understand the stock market without losing your cool. In this episode, Lloyd James Ross unpacks why markets dip, how investors usually react, and what you can do instead. He breaks down the different types of downturns—because not every drop is a disaster—and explains why so many people panic when they don’t need to. Lloyd also shares why keeping your head clear matters and hints at ways to build financial stability no matter what the market’s doing.
